Zack Snyder’s Justice League Introduction Was Supposed To Be Much Different (Exclusive)

The Justice League was never supposed to arrive as email attachments.

But that is how Warner Bros. introduced half the team in Batman v Superman, and according to insiders I spoke with at Comic-Con, it was not Zack Snyder’s original plan.

Snyder Had A Different Justice League Introduction

I was told at Comic-Con that Snyder originally planned to introduce the Justice League much differently than the cameos dropped into Batman v Superman.

No further details were offered about what that plan looked like.

Only that the version audiences got was not the version Snyder had in mind.

The Justice League Arrived On A Laptop

You know the scene.

Wonder Woman opens Lex Luthor’s metahuman files and finds the future Justice League waiting inside.

Flash stops a convenience store robbery. Aquaman surfaces for a camera. Cyborg appears in lab footage.

They even had custom logos.

The scene was years of world-building crushed into a laptop screen.

Even people who will defend Batman v Superman all day, especially the Ultimate Edition, can recognize what happened: Warner Bros. hit the fast-forward button.

Warner Bros. Wanted Its Avengers Immediately

The insider claim lines up with what has been known for years.

Snyder was pushed onto the Justice League track by Warner Bros. executives desperate to answer Marvel’s Avengers.

Marvel spent five solo movies building toward its team-up. Warner Bros. tried to skip the build and jump straight to the payoff.

The Man of Steel sequel became Dawn of Justice, and Justice League was planned to be shot back-to-back.

The entire universe was ordered to stand up at once.

Those file cameos were not some inspired piece of storytelling. They were the studio mandate made visible.

What the insider account adds is that Snyder had another way into the Justice League before Warner Bros. forced the issue.

Whatever that plan was, audiences never got to see it.

Snyder Still Wants To Finish The Story

Snyder lost the introduction he wanted, and his Justice League never got its ending either.

That unfinished story is now back at the center of the conversation.

Snyder spent Saturday night on stage with Frank Miller answering a “we want Justice League 2” chant with a jab at the studio. He also said a Dark Knight Returns movie happens “when they let us.”

As CBN exclusively reported, Snyder is gung ho about finishing his Justice League arc once the Paramount deal closes.

The same insiders also say Christopher Nolan chose Snyder to take over DC in the first place.

Warner Bros. took Snyder’s introduction away from him.

The ending may still be his to finish.
